BATTERY OPERATION

Disconnect the AC power cord from the AC
socket of the unit. Battery power is cut
a ut om at ic a ll y wh il e t he c o rd t he i s
connected.

When the volume decreases, or the sound
distorts, replace all of the batteries with new
ones.

AC OPERATION

Connect the smaller end of the AC power
cord to the AC socket on the back cabinet.
Insert the plug into your 120 volt 60Hz
household AC outlet.

CAUTION
To prevent electrical shock, match wide
blade of plug to wide slot and insert fully.
